Understanding the Common Causes of Flat Cookies

When you bite into a cookie, you expect it to be chewy or crispy, not flat and lifeless. One common cause of flat cookies is too much cookie spread, which can happen if you’ve added too much sugar or fat. These ingredients melt during baking, leaving you with a sad, thin cookie.

Another culprit could be the use of insufficient baking soda. This leavening agent helps your cookies rise and maintain their shape. If you don’t measure it correctly, your cookies mightn’t get the lift they need. Additionally, properly creaming butter and sugar can help incorporate air into the dough, preventing excessive spreading. Balancing butter temperature is also essential in achieving the right texture and height for your cookies.

Finally, overmixing your dough can lead to excess gluten development, making your cookies spread even more. Keep these factors in mind to avoid those disappointing flat cookies next time! Additionally, improper butter temperature can significantly affect the texture and height of your cookies.

Flour To Fat Ratio

Understanding the flour to fat ratio is essential for achieving the perfect cookie texture. The balance between flour types and fat can make or break your cookie. If you use too much flour, your cookies might turn out dry and crumbly. Conversely, too much fat can lead to flat, greasy cookies.

Aim for a ratio that allows the dough to hold its shape while still being tender. Also, consider fat temperatures; using softened butter versus melted can impact how your cookies spread. Softened fat incorporates air, creating a lighter texture, while melted fat leads to denser cookies. Sugar Types Impact Texture

While you mightn’t think about it, the type of sugar you use can markedly impact your cookie’s texture. Granulated sugar tends to create a crispier cookie, while brown sugar adds moisture, resulting in a chewier texture.

Using powdered sugar can lead to a softer, more tender cookie due to its fine texture and moisture content. If you’re considering sugar substitutes, be mindful of their different properties, as they can alter your cookie’s structure and flavor. baking temperature affects cookies

Baking temperature markedly influences cookie shape, as even a slight variation can lead to flat or puffy results.

Baking temperature plays a crucial role in cookie shape, with even minor adjustments yielding flat or puffy results.

When you bake at a lower temperature, your cookies tend to spread more before they set, resulting in a flatter shape. Conversely, higher temperatures cause the edges to firm up quickly, allowing the centers to rise, giving you a thicker, puffier cookie.

It’s essential to preheat your oven properly; if it’s not hot enough, your dough won’t hold its shape.

Experimenting with different baking temperatures can help you achieve the desired cookie shape. So, keep an eye on that oven thermometer, and adjust accordingly for the perfect batch every time!

Creaming Method Explained

While many factors influence cookie density, the creaming method stands out as a pivotal technique in your baking arsenal. This method involves mixing softened butter and sugar until you achieve a light, fluffy cream consistency.

The key here is butter temperature; it should be soft but not melted. If your butter’s too cold, it won’t incorporate air properly, leading to denser cookies. Aim for a pale, creamy mixture, which indicates you’ve incorporated enough air.

Proper creaming not only affects texture but also the cookie’s rise. Remember, the longer you cream, the more air gets trapped, giving your cookies that delightful lift. Master this technique, and you’ll be on your way to cookies that are anything but flat!

Mixing Speed Effects

Mixing speed plays an essential role in determining cookie density and texture. When you mix your dough at high speed, you incorporate more air, leading to a lighter, fluffier cookie.

However, too much mixing can overwork the gluten, causing the dough to become tough and dense. If you prefer a chewier texture, opt for a slower mixing speed. This helps maintain the dough consistency without over-developing the gluten structure.

It’s vital to find the right balance; mixing just enough to combine ingredients while preserving the dough’s integrity is key. Experiment with different speeds to see how they affect your cookies.

How to Choose the Right Baking Sheet for Optimal Results

Choosing the right baking sheet can make all the difference in achieving perfectly baked cookies. Start by considering baking sheet materials. Heavy-gauge aluminum is a great choice for even heat distribution, while non-stick sheets can help your cookies release easily.

Selecting the right baking sheet is essential for achieving perfectly baked cookies, with materials like heavy-gauge aluminum ensuring even heat distribution.

Avoid dark-colored sheets, as they can cause uneven browning.

Next, think about cookie sheet sizes. Standard half-sheet pans are versatile and fit most ovens, but if you’re making larger batches, opt for full-size sheets. Having multiple sizes allows you to bake different cookie types simultaneously.

Finally, make certain your baking sheets are free from warps or dents, as they can affect how your cookies bake. With the right tools, you’ll be well on your way to baking success!

Troubleshooting: Fixing Flat Cookies in Your Next Batch

Even with the right baking sheets, you might still pull out a batch of flat cookies. To troubleshoot, first check your dough consistency; it should be thick and not too sticky.

If you made ingredient substitutions, they could affect your results, so stick to the recipe when possible. Confirm your oven calibration is accurate—invest in an oven thermometer if needed.

Humidity effects can also play a role, so consider adjusting your flour if it’s particularly humid. If you live at a high altitude, be prepared for altitude adjustments in your recipe.

Finally, allow your dough a proper rest period to enhance flavor and structure. With these tips, you’ll be on your way to perfect cookies!
